sweetheart
Americannoun
-
either of a pair of lovers in relation to the other.
-
(sometimes initial capital letter) an affectionate or familiar term of address.
-
a beloved person.
-
Informal. a generous, friendly person.
-
Informal. anything that arouses loyal affection.
My old car was a real sweetheart.

Etymology
Origin of sweetheart
First recorded in 1250–1300, sweetheart is from Middle English swete herte. See sweet, heart
